Type: Full Time Wage: $70,000 - $75,000 Annual Salary Based on Experience Schedule: Monday - Friday 8am - 4:30pm - Must be Flexible Location: Cornwall, ON - Onsite In Office Role Requirements: HR Generalist Experience Required Relocation Allowance: $2,500 Summary This is an HR generalist role that is both tactical and strategic, focused on maximizing employee engagement and development. These roles are located in larger warehouse locations and/or high density geographical areas. They are high-touch and customer focused roles, and require the onsite HR generalist to partner heavily with operations to support our employees. This Onsite HR partner understands everything from employee relations to performance management, talent management to succession planning and employee engagement and legislative compliance. They are business partners to the warehouse management teams in all areas of the employee life cycle.
